> The last thing LT_PATH_LD does is to expand _LT_PATH_LD_GNU, which runs the
> linker with -v and looks for "GNU" or "with BFD" in the output and assumes
> GNU ld if that is found. The result is stored in $with_gnu_ld (and a cache
> variable).
>
> If inside configure, I think it's fairly safe to just use $with_gnu_ld,
> that's probably not going to change anytime soon.
>
> Outside configure, evaluate something like:
>
> .../libtool --config | grep '^with_gnu_ld='
